This company is a trailblazer in sustainable waste management and recycling. They are proud to be at the forefront of change with their state-of-the-art Materials Recycling Facility located in Coventry. As a joint venture between eight local authorities in the West Midlands, they serve over 1.5 million residents, ensuring that the future is not just sustainable but also efficient. Their cutting-edge facility leverages AI technology to process dry mixed kerbside residential recycling, setting a new standard in quality and environmental responsibility. About the role:
As a Maintenance Engineer, you will play a pivotal role in maintaining their advanced facility. Your primary objective will be to ensure the seamless operation of their plant machinery, contributing to their mission of efficient waste management. You will be responsible for preventative maintenance, quick troubleshooting, and minimising downtime, allowing them to serve their community better than ever before.
Main duties and responsibilities:
* Conduct Planned Preventative Maintenance (PPM) in accordance with OEM specifications and meticulously record data in their CMMS.
* Monitor, engage, and support operational staff to ensure safety and efficiency across shifts.
* Adhere to and uphold health and safety compliance, ensuring a safe working environment for all.
* Provide immediate support to operators as needed and oversee timely plant repairs.
* Collaborate with the cleaning team to monitor and maintain performance standards.
* Step into the role of team leader during their absence, fostering a collaborative environment, as well as mentoring junior team members to promote training, compliance, and a culture of continuous improvement.
About you:
They are looking for a dynamic Maintenance Engineer who embodies a spirit of collaboration and innovation. You will bring proven experience in on-site maintenance, specifically with heavy equipment such as conveyors, motors, and hydraulics, complemented by a minimum level 3 apprenticeship in engineering or a related field. Your strong problem-solving skills and ability to work effectively under tight schedules in a planned maintenance environment are essential. A commitment to health and safety practices is crucial, and experience with PLC-based systems and within the waste management industry will set you apart.
